|  | /* $OpenBSD: sc25519.c,v 1.3 2013/12/09 11:03:45 markus Exp $ */ | 
|  |  | 
|  | /* | 
|  | * Public Domain, Authors: Daniel J. Bernstein, Niels Duif, Tanja Lange, | 
|  | * Peter Schwabe, Bo-Yin Yang. | 
|  | * Copied from supercop-20130419/crypto_sign/ed25519/ref/sc25519.c | 
|  | */ | 
|  |  | 
|  | #include "includes.h" | 
|  |  | 
|  | #include "sc25519.h" | 
|  |  | 
|  | /*Arithmetic modulo the group order m = 2^252 +  27742317777372353535851937790883648493 = 7237005577332262213973186563042994240857116359379907606001950938285454250989 */ | 
|  |  | 
|  | static const crypto_uint32 m[32] = {0xED, 0xD3, 0xF5, 0x5C, 0x1A, 0x63, 0x12, 0x58, 0xD6, 0x9C, 0xF7, 0xA2, 0xDE, 0xF9, 0xDE, 0x14, | 
|  | 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x10}; | 
|  |  | 
|  | static const crypto_uint32 mu[33] = {0x1B, 0x13, 0x2C, 0x0A, 0xA3, 0xE5, 0x9C, 0xED, 0xA7, 0x29, 0x63, 0x08, 0x5D, 0x21, 0x06, 0x21, | 
|  | 0xEB,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0x0F}; | 
|  |  | 
|  | static crypto_uint32 lt(crypto_uint32 a,crypto_uint32 b) /* 16-bit inputs */ | 
|  | { | 
|  | unsigned int x = a; | 
|  | x -= (unsigned int) b; /* 0..65535: no; 4294901761..4294967295: yes */ | 
|  | x >>= 31; /* 0: no; 1: yes */ | 
|  | return x; | 
|  | } |

|  | /* Reduce coefficients of r before calling reduce_add_sub */ | 
|  | static void reduce_add_sub(sc25519 *r) | 
|  | { | 
|  | crypto_uint32 pb = 0; | 
|  | crypto_uint32 b; | 
|  | crypto_uint32 mask; | 
|  | int i; | 
|  | unsigned char t[32]; | 
|  |  | 
|  | for(i=0;i<32;i++) | 
|  | { | 
|  | pb += m[i]; | 
|  | b = lt(r->v[i],pb); | 
|  | t[i] = r->v[i]-pb+(b<<8); | 
|  | pb = b; | 
|  | } | 
|  | mask = b - 1; | 
|  | for(i=0;i<32;i++) | 
|  | r->v[i] ^= mask & (r->v[i] ^ t[i]); | 
|  | } | 
|  |  | 
|  | /* Reduce coefficients of x before calling barrett_reduce */ | 
|  | static void barrett_reduce(sc25519 *r, const crypto_uint32 x[64]) | 
|  | { | 
|  | /* See HAC, Alg. 14.42 */ | 
|  | int i,j; | 
|  | crypto_uint32 q2[66]; | 
|  | crypto_uint32 *q3 = q2 + 33; | 
|  | crypto_uint32 r1[33]; | 
|  | crypto_uint32 r2[33]; | 
|  | crypto_uint32 carry; | 
|  | crypto_uint32 pb = 0; | 
|  | crypto_uint32 b; | 
|  |  | 
|  | for (i = 0;i < 66;++i) q2[i] = 0; | 
|  | for (i = 0;i < 33;++i) r2[i] = 0; | 
|  |  | 
|  | for(i=0;i<33;i++) | 
|  | for(j=0;j<33;j++) | 
|  | if(i+j >= 31) q2[i+j] += mu[i]*x[j+31]; | 
|  | carry = q2[31] >> 8; | 
|  | q2[32] += carry; | 
|  | carry = q2[32] >> 8; | 
|  | q2[33] += carry; | 
|  |  | 
|  | for(i=0;i<33;i++)r1[i] = x[i]; | 
|  | for(i=0;i<32;i++) | 
|  | for(j=0;j<33;j++) | 
|  | if(i+j < 33) r2[i+j] += m[i]*q3[j]; | 
|  |  | 
|  | for(i=0;i<32;i++) | 
|  | { | 
|  | carry = r2[i] >> 8; | 
|  | r2[i+1] += carry; | 
|  | r2[i] &= 0xff; | 
|  | } | 
|  |  | 
|  | for(i=0;i<32;i++) | 
|  | { | 
|  | pb += r2[i]; | 
|  | b = lt(r1[i],pb); | 
|  | r->v[i] = r1[i]-pb+(b<<8); | 
|  | pb = b; | 
|  | } | 
|  |  | 
|  | /* XXX: Can it really happen that r<0?, See HAC, Alg 14.42, Step 3 | 
|  | * If so: Handle  it here! | 
|  | */ | 
|  |  | 
|  | reduce_add_sub(r); | 
|  | reduce_add_sub(r); | 
|  | } |

|  | void sc25519_from32bytes(sc25519 *r, const unsigned char x[32]) | 
|  | { | 
|  | int i; | 
|  | crypto_uint32 t[64]; | 
|  | for(i=0;i<32;i++) t[i] = x[i]; | 
|  | for(i=32;i<64;++i) t[i] = 0; | 
|  | barrett_reduce(r, t); | 
|  | } | 
|  |  | 
|  | void shortsc25519_from16bytes(shortsc25519 *r, const unsigned char x[16]) | 
|  | { | 
|  | int i; | 
|  | for(i=0;i<16;i++) r->v[i] = x[i]; | 
|  | } | 
|  |  | 
|  | void sc25519_from64bytes(sc25519 *r, const unsigned char x[64]) | 
|  | { | 
|  | int i; | 
|  | crypto_uint32 t[64]; | 
|  | for(i=0;i<64;i++) t[i] = x[i]; | 
|  | barrett_reduce(r, t); | 
|  | } | 
|  |  | 
|  | void sc25519_from_shortsc(sc25519 *r, const shortsc25519 *x) | 
|  | { | 
|  | int i; | 
|  | for(i=0;i<16;i++) | 
|  | r->v[i] = x->v[i]; | 
|  | for(i=0;i<16;i++) | 
|  | r->v[16+i] = 0; | 
|  | } | 
|  |  | 
|  | void sc25519_to32bytes(unsigned char r[32], const sc25519 *x) | 
|  | { | 
|  | int i; | 
|  | for(i=0;i<32;i++) r[i] = x->v[i]; | 
|  | } | 
|  |  | 
|  | int sc25519_iszero_vartime(const sc25519 *x) | 
|  | { | 
|  | int i; | 
|  | for(i=0;i<32;i++) | 
|  | if(x->v[i] != 0) return 0; | 
|  | return 1; | 
|  | } | 
|  |  | 
|  | int sc25519_isshort_vartime(const sc25519 *x) | 
|  | { | 
|  | int i; | 
|  | for(i=31;i>15;i--) | 
|  | if(x->v[i] != 0) return 0; | 
|  | return 1; | 
|  | } | 
|  |  | 
|  | int sc25519_lt_vartime(const sc25519 *x, const sc25519 *y) | 
|  | { | 
|  | int i; | 
|  | for(i=31;i>=0;i--) | 
|  | { | 
|  | if(x->v[i] < y->v[i]) return 1; | 
|  | if(x->v[i] > y->v[i]) return 0; | 
|  | } | 
|  | return 0; | 
|  | } | 
|  |  | 
|  | void sc25519_add(sc25519 *r, const sc25519 *x, const sc25519 *y) | 
|  | { | 
|  | int i, carry; | 
|  | for(i=0;i<32;i++) r->v[i] = x->v[i] + y->v[i]; | 
|  | for(i=0;i<31;i++) | 
|  | { | 
|  | carry = r->v[i] >> 8; | 
|  | r->v[i+1] += carry; | 
|  | r->v[i] &= 0xff; | 
|  | } | 
|  | reduce_add_sub(r); | 
|  | } | 
|  |  | 
|  | void sc25519_sub_nored(sc25519 *r, const sc25519 *x, const sc25519 *y) | 
|  | { | 
|  | crypto_uint32 b = 0; | 
|  | crypto_uint32 t; | 
|  | int i; | 
|  | for(i=0;i<32;i++) | 
|  | { | 
|  | t = x->v[i] - y->v[i] - b; | 
|  | r->v[i] = t & 255; | 
|  | b = (t >> 8) & 1; | 
|  | } | 
|  | } | 
|  |  | 
|  | void sc25519_mul(sc25519 *r, const sc25519 *x, const sc25519 *y) | 
|  | { | 
|  | int i,j,carry; | 
|  | crypto_uint32 t[64]; | 
|  | for(i=0;i<64;i++)t[i] = 0; | 
|  |  | 
|  | for(i=0;i<32;i++) | 
|  | for(j=0;j<32;j++) | 
|  | t[i+j] += x->v[i] * y->v[j]; | 
|  |  | 
|  | /* Reduce coefficients */ | 
|  | for(i=0;i<63;i++) | 
|  | { | 
|  | carry = t[i] >> 8; | 
|  | t[i+1] += carry; | 
|  | t[i] &= 0xff; | 
|  | } | 
|  |  | 
|  | barrett_reduce(r, t); | 
|  | } |
